VEHICLE STABILITY CONTROL SYSTEM, Diagnostic DTC:C1434

DTC Code DTC Name
C1434 Steering Angle Sensor Output Malfunction

DESCRIPTION

Spiral cable sub-assembly (steering sensor) signals are sent to the skid control ECU (brake actuator assembly) via the CAN communication system. When there is a malfunction in the CAN communication system, it will be detected by the steering sensor zero point malfunction diagnostic function.

DTC NO. DTC Detection Condition Trouble Area
C1434 Error in communication between the skid control ECU (brake actuator assembly) and the spiral cable sub-assembly (steering sensor), or abnormal steering sensor zero point.
  • Steering sensor power supply

  • Spiral cable sub-assembly (steering sensor)

  • Skid control ECU (brake actuator assembly)

CAUTION / NOTICE / HINT

Note


  • Do not remove the steering sensor from the spiral cable sub-assembly.

  • When replacing the spiral cable sub-assembly (steering sensor), confirm that the replacement part is of the correct specification.

  • Inspect the fuses for circuits related to this system before performing the following inspection procedure.

Tech Tips


  • When U0073, U0124 and/or U0126 is output together with C1434, inspect and repair the trouble areas indicated by U0073, U0124 and/or U0126 first Click here.

  • When any of the speed sensors or the center airbag sensor assembly (yaw rate sensor) has trouble, DTCs for the spiral cable sub-assembly (steering sensor) may be output even when the spiral cable sub-assembly (steering sensor) is normal. When DTCs for the speed sensors or center airbag sensor assembly (yaw rate sensor) are output together with DTCs for the spiral cable sub-assembly (steering sensor), inspect and repair the speed sensor and center airbag sensor assembly (yaw rate sensor) first, and then inspect and repair the spiral cable sub-assembly (steering sensor).

PROCEDURE


  1. CHECK DTC


    1. Clear the DTCs Click here.

    2. Turn the ignition switch off.

    3. Turn the ignition switch to ON again and check that no CAN communication system DTC is output Click here.

    4. Start the engine.

    5. Drive the vehicle and turn the steering wheel to the right and left at a speed of 35 km/h (22 mph) and check that no speed sensor or yaw rate and deceleration sensor DTCs are output Click here.

      Result
      Result Proceed to
      No CAN communication system, speed sensor, or yaw rate and acceleration sensor DTCs are output A
      CAN communication system DTC is output B
      Speed sensor or yaw rate and acceleration sensor DTC is output C

      Tech Tips


      • If there is a malfunction in any of the speed sensors or the center airbag sensor assembly (yaw rate sensor), an abnormal value may be output although the spiral cable sub-assembly (steering sensor) is normal.

      • If speed sensor and center airbag sensor assembly (yaw rate sensor) DTCs are output simultaneously, repair these two sensors first and inspect the spiral cable sub-assembly (steering sensor).

  2. CHECK TERMINAL VOLTAGE (IG, BAT)


    1. A005HVDE01
      Text in Illustration
      *a

      Front view of wire harness connector

      (to Spiral Cable Sub-assembly (Steering sensor))

      Remove the steering wheel and the lower column cover.

    2. Make sure that there is no looseness at the locking part and the connecting part of the connectors.

    3. Disconnect the F30 spiral cable sub-assembly (steering sensor) connector.

    4. Measure the voltage according to the value(s) in the table below.

      Standard Voltage
      Tester Connection Switch Condition Specified Condition
      F30-5 (IG) - Body ground Ignition switch ON 11 to 14 V
      F30-6 (BAT) - Body ground Always 11 to 14 V
    5. Reconnect the F30 spiral cable sub-assembly (steering sensor) connector.

    6. Reinstall the steering wheel and the lower column cover.
